If the magnetic field in a particular pulse has a magnitude of 1x10-5T (comparable to the Earth's magnetic field). What is the magnitude of the associated electric field?

The magnitude of the associated electric field is3000V/m

Step by step solution

01

Identification of given data

Magnitude of magnetic fieldB=1×10-5T

02

Concept of Ampere’s law

It states that the pulse of the electric field and magnetic field is travelling through space with speed of light. It is given as

E=cB …(i)

Where, Eis the electric field, Bis the magnetic field and c is the speed of light

03

Determining the magnitude of the associated electric field

Substituting all the values in equation (i)

E=3×108m/s×1×10-5T=3000V/m

Hence the magnitude of the associated electric field is3000V/m
